What does unacceptableness mean?
Definitions for unacceptableness
un·ac·cept·able·ness
This dictionary definitions page includes all the possible meanings, example usage and translations of the word unacceptableness.
Princeton's WordNet
unacceptability, unacceptablenessnoun
unsatisfactoriness by virtue of not conforming to approved standards
Wiktionary
unacceptablenessnoun
Unacceptability.
Samuel Johnson's Dictionary
Unacceptablenessnoun
State of not pleasing.
Etymology: from unacceptable.
This alteration arises from the unacceptableness of the subject I am upon. Jeremy Collier, on Pride.
ChatGPT
unacceptableness
Unacceptableness is the state or condition of being unacceptable or not meeting required standards, expectations, or norms. This could be due to being inappropriate, offensive, undesirable, or objectionable in some way. It refers to something that cannot or should not be allowed or tolerated, often because it is harmful, unethical, or unsuitable.
